I have just received a letter from my doctor stating to save money they are changing all Yasmin prescriptions to Lucette and that it's exactly the same.

I really like being on Yasmin. I have cystic ovaries and insulin resistance. Before Yasmin I was on microgynon and my weight shot up. I'm at a comfortable weight, could lose half a stone but that's life, I really don't want to take something new which will result in weight gain, PMT, arsey moods, spots etc like I've had microgynon.
Has anyone else been made to switch?
